Transaction 3269440832f91f66bdddde6690ce66960f282fe101f944f63150cd0d981f5a36
1 Input
1 Output
-
3269440832f91f66bdddde6690ce66960f282fe101f944f63150cd0d981f5a36:0
- value
- 152975204
- script pubkey
- OP_0 OP_PUSHBYTES_20 9b8adcd29b6ae6455666cdd22117968a89c6d325
- address
- bc1qnw9de55mdtny24nxehfzz9uk32yud5e9s3asqw